The successful Health and Safety Manager will be responsible for:

  • Providing health and safety leadership across a portfolio of live infrastructure and capital projects
  • Carrying out audits, inspections, and operational reviews across multiple sites
  • Supporting and mentoring members of the Health and Safety team across the region
  • Leading investigations into incidents and supporting corrective actions
  • Reviewing safety performance data, identifying trends, and driving improvements
  • Working closely with clients, operational teams, and subcontractors to maintain standards
  • Supporting safe delivery across high risk activities including excavation, underground services, lifting operations, temporary works, and major civils activities

The ideal Health and Safety Manager will have:

  • NEBOSH Diploma, NVQ Level 6, or equivalent as a minimum
  • Experience within utilities, infrastructure, civil engineering, construction, or another high-risk operational environment

How to prepare for a job interview at Principal People Recruitment

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your health and safety regulations, especially those relevant to the infrastructure and utilities sector. Familiarise yourself with NEBOSH standards and any recent changes in legislation that could impact the role.

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past roles where you've successfully led health and safety initiatives. Highlight your experience in high-risk environments and how you've influenced teams to improve safety performance.

Build Rapport

Since this role involves working closely with various teams, practice building rapport during the interview. Be friendly and approachable, and demonstrate your ability to communicate effectively with operational teams and subcontractors.

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's safety culture and their approach to managing high-risk activities.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if the company aligns with your values.
